N-{2-[(4-acetyl-1-piperazinyl)methyl]-1-methyl-1H-benzimidazol-5-yl}cyclohexanecarboxamide
TL;DR: N-{2-[(4-acetyl-1-piperazinyl)methyl]-1-methyl-1H-benzimidazol-5-yl}cyclohexanecarboxamide (CAS 825656-15-3) is a chemical compound with molecular formula C22H31N5O2 and molecular weight 397.25 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
N-[2-[(4-acetylpiperazin-1-yl)methyl]-1-methylbenzimidazol-5-yl]cyclohexanecarboxamide
Also Known As: N-{2-[(4-acetyl-1-piperazinyl)methyl]-1-methyl-1H-benzimidazol-5-yl}cyclohexanecarboxamide, N-[2-[(4-acetylpiperazin-1-yl)methyl]-1-methylbenzimidazol-5-yl]cyclohexanecarboxamide, N-{2-[(4-acetylpiperazin-1-yl)methyl]-1-methyl-1H-benzimidazol-5-yl}cyclohexanecarboxamide, N-(2-((4-acetylpiperazin-1-yl)methyl)-1-methyl-1H-benzo[d]imidazol-5-yl)cyclohexanecarboxamide, N-{2-[(4-ACETYLPIPERAZIN-1-YL)METHYL]-1-METHYL-1H-1,3-BENZODIAZOL-5-YL}CYCLOHEXANECARBOXAMIDE
| Molecular Formula | C22H31N5O2 |
|---|---|
| Molecular Weight | 397.25 g/mol |
| LogP | 2.7562 |
| Topological Polar Surface Area | 70.47 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 4 |
| Rotatable Bonds | 4 |
| Exact Mass | 397.24777 |
| Heavy Atoms | 29 |
| Complexity | 891.9848 |
Chemical Identifiers
| CAS Number | 825656-15-3 |
|---|---|
| SMILES | CC(=O)N1CCN(CC1)CC2=NC3=C(N2C)C=CC(=C3)NC(=O)C4CCCCC4 |
